    Transducer for Fetal Heart Rate Market Summary

    The Global Transducer for Fetal Heart Rate Market is projected to grow from 1.83 USD Billion in 2024 to 2.99 USD Billion by 2035.

    Key Market Trends & Highlights

    Transducer for Fetal Heart Rate Key Trends and Highlights

    • The market is expected to experience a compound annual growth rate (CAGR) of 4.57 percent from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 2.99 USD Billion, indicating robust growth.
    • In 2024, the market is valued at 1.83 USD Billion, reflecting a strong foundation for future expansion.
    • Growing adoption of advanced monitoring technologies due to increasing awareness of fetal health is a major market driver.

    Market Size & Forecast

    2024 Market Size 1.83 (USD Billion)
    2035 Market Size 2.99 (USD Billion)
    CAGR (2025-2035) 4.57%

    Regional Insights

    The Transducer for Fetal Heart Rate Market is witnessing notable growth across various regions, contributing significantly to the overall market landscape. In 2023, North America holds a majority share valued at 0.75 USD Billion, which is expected to rise to 1.1 USD Billion by 2032, demonstrating its dominance due to advanced healthcare infrastructure and increasing awareness towards maternal health.

    Europe follows, with a valuation of 0.5 USD Billion in 2023, projected to reach 0.75 USD Billion in 2032, reflecting the region's strong emphasis on prenatal care technologies.The Asia Pacific (APAC) region, valued at 0.3 USD Billion in 2023 and increasing to 0.5 USD Billion by 2032, is becoming significant due to rising birth rates and healthcare investments. South America, although smaller with a valuation of 0.05 USD Billion in 2023, is anticipated to see growth to 0.1 USD Billion by 2032 as healthcare access improves.

    Meanwhile, the Middle East and Africa (MEA) segment, currently valued at 0.07 USD Billion and slightly declining to 0.05 USD Billion, presents challenges related to healthcare resource allocation, impacting its growth potential.Overall, the market is influenced by trends in maternal health technology, with opportunities for expansion and innovation across all regions.
